stripslashesQuita las barras de un string con comillas escapadas
&reftitle.description;
stringstripslashesstringstr
Quita las barras de un string con comillas escapadas.
Si magic_quotes_sybase está
activo, ninguna barra invertida será retirada pero dos apóstrofes serán reemplazados
por uno.
Un ejemplo de uso de stripslashes es cuando la directiva
de PHP magic_quotes_gpc
es on (estaba activado por defecto antes de PHP 5.4) y no se están insertando
estos datos en un lugar (como una base de datos) que requiera escapado.
Por ejemplo, si simplemente se le da salida a los datos directamente desde un formulario HTML.
&reftitle.parameters;
str
El string de entrada.
&reftitle.returnvalues;
Devuelve un string con las barras invertidas retiradas.
(\' se convierte en ' y así sucesivamente.)
Barras invertidas dobles (\\) se convierten en una
sencilla (\).
&reftitle.examples;
Un ejemplo de stripslashes
]]>
stripslashes no es recursiva. Si se desea aplicar
esta función a un array multi-dimensional, se necesita utilizar una función
recursiva.
Utilizando stripslashes en un array
]]>
&example.outputs;
f'oo
[1] => b'ar
[2] => Array
(
[0] => fo'o
[1] => b'ar
)
)
]]>
&reftitle.seealso;
addslashesget_magic_quotes_gpc